网站大量收购闲置独家精品文档,联系QQ:2885784924

Hadoop开发环境搭建[Win8EclipseLinux].docxVIP

  1. 1、本文档共12页,可阅读全部内容。
  2. 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  5. 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  6. 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  7. 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  8. 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
Hadoop开发环境搭建(Win8+Linux)常见的Hadoop开发环境架构有以下三种:Eclipse与Hadoop集群在同一台Windows机器上。Eclipse与Hadoop集群在同一台Linux机器上。Eclipse在Windows上,Hadoop集群在远程Linux机器上。点评:第一种架构:必须安装cygwin,Hadoop对Windows的支持有限,在Windows上部署hadoop会出现相当多诡异的问题。第二种架构:Hadoop机器运行在Linux上完全没有问题,但是有大部分的开发者不习惯在Linux上做开发。这种架构适合习惯使用Linux的开发者。第三种架构:Hadoop集群部署在Linux上,保证了稳定性,Eclipse在Windows上,符合大部分开发者的习惯。本文主要介绍第三种Hadoop开发环境架构的搭建方法。Hadoop开发环境的搭建分为两大块:Hadoop集群搭建、Eclipse环境搭建。其中Hadoop集群搭建可参考官方文档,本文主要讲解Eclipse环境搭建(如何在Eclipse中查看和操作HDFS、如何在Eclipse中执行MapReduce作业)。搭建步骤:搭建Hadoop集群(Linux、JDK6、Hadoop-1.1.2)在Windows上安装JDK6+在Windows上安装Eclipse3.3+在Eclipse上安装hadoop-eclipse-plugin-1.1.2.jar插件(如果没有,则需自行编译源码)在Eclipse上配置Map/Reduce Location搭建Hadoop集群此步骤可参考Hadoop官方文档在Windows上安装JDK此步骤可参考官方文档在Window上安装Eclipse此步骤可参考官方文档在Eclipse上安装hadoop-eclipse-plugin-1.1.2.jar插件Hadoop-1.1.2的发布包里面没有hadoop-eclipse-plugin-1.1.2.jar,开发者必须根据所在的环境自行编译hadoop-eclipse-plugin-1.1.2.jar插件。以下为自行编译hadoop-eclipse-plugin-1.1.2.jar的步骤:安装Ant(参考官方文档)修改${HADOOP_HOME}/src/contrib/eclipse-plugin/build.xml文件以下是笔者机器上的build.xml文件,可以以此作为模版,修改相应的节点即可(其中红色部分为需要修改的节点)。?xml version=1.0 encoding=UTF-8 standalone=no? project default=jar name=eclipse-plugin property name=name value=${}/ property name=root value=${basedir}/ property name=hadoop.root location=D:\cygwin64\home\lenovo\hadoop-1.1.2/ property name=version value=1.1.2/ property name=eclipse.home location=E:\eclipse4.1\eclipse/ property name=build.dir location=${hadoop.root}/build/contrib/${name}/ property name=build.classes location=${build.dir}/classes/ property name=src.dir location=${root}/src/java/ path id=eclipse-sdk-jars fileset dir=${eclipse.home}/plugins/ include name=org.eclipse.ui*.jar/ include name=org.eclipse.jdt*.jar/ include name=org.eclipse.core*.jar/ include name=org.eclipse.equinox*.jar/ include name=org.eclipse.debug*.jar/ include name=org.eclipse.osgi*.jar/ include name=org.eclipse.swt*.jar/ include name=org.eclipse.jface*.jar/ include name=org.eclipse.team.cvs.ssh2*.jar/ include name=com.jcraft.jsc

文档评论(0)

wuyoujun92 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档